  10. Hi Tom, I obtained a replacement canopy for an F/A 18a which was out of production direct from Italeri. They forwarded it to their UK distributors, The Hobby Company, who sent it on to me. Italrei's email is [email protected] You can find the Hobby Company's details online if you want to try them first, but Italeri worked for me Ronnie
